Woman on bicycle struck, killed by truck near Auburn

(FOX40.COM) — A woman who was riding her bike with someone else was fatally struck by a truck near Auburn Monday morning, according to the California Highway Patrol.

The agency said the crash happened around 10:50 a.m. on Lozanos Rd. close to Ophir Elementary School, which was placed on a lockdown temporarily.

The 60-year-old woman was riding with someone else when she was struck, the CHP said.

“Our deepest condolences go out to the family and friends of the victim during this incredibly difficult time,” the CHP said. “Our thoughts are with the loved ones of the cyclist, and we mourn alongside them.”

The agency said that it is still determining what caused the crash and is asking anyone who travels through the area to use caution, highlighting the importance of safety and vigilance for all road users, including cyclists.
